
Charli XCX celebrates birthday by announcing upcoming single "Good Ones"
On top of celebrating her 29th birthday today (2 August), Charli XCX has announced her forthcoming single "Good Ones", which will arrive in a month's time.
Charli XCX turns 29 today (2 August), and to celebrate her birthday she's gifted fans with the announcement of her next single "Good Ones".
"Good Ones" will be unveiled next month, and will mark Charli XCX's first new music since collaborating with A. G. Cook on "Xcxoplex" back in May.

Back in March Charli XCX teased that her next album will be "POPTASTIC", and has since revealed she's been working on music with Tove Lo, and texted Rina Sawayama about making a song together.
She's also expected to contribute a remix of "911" for the upcoming remix of Lady Gaga's Chromatica album being put together by BloodPop.
